什么是时间序列补丁?
时间: 2024-06-23 17:00:19 浏览: 8
时间序列补丁(Time Series Patches)是一种在时间序列分析中常用的技术,它涉及到对数据进行局部或增量的更新,而不是完全重置整个序列。这种技术常用于处理实时或流式数据,比如在物联网、金融交易、社交媒体等场景中,数据可能会不断生成并且需要对新的数据点进行适应和预测。
时间序列补丁通常应用于以下情况:
1. **在线学习**:当模型需要处理大量实时数据,一次性加载所有数据不切实际时,可以通过补丁更新模型,仅用新数据点替换部分模型参数。
2. **增量更新**:对于大型时间序列数据库,可以定期或按需应用补丁,只更新最近的数据变化,提高存储效率和计算性能。
3. **异常检测**:在检测到新数据点可能带来的模式变化时,使用补丁可以帮助模型更快地响应这些变化。
4. **预测模型维护**:在预测模型中,当新的观测值可用时,通过补丁更新预测方法,而不是每次都需要重新训练整个模型。
相关问题
时序嵌入补丁是什么意思
### 回答1:
时序嵌入补丁(Temporal Embedding Patch)是一种用于处理序列数据的技术,通常应用于卷积神经网络(CNN)中。它的作用是将时间维度的信息加入到序列数据中,使得模型可以更好地理解数据中的时间关系。具体来说,时序嵌入补丁会将每个时间步的数据向量与一个对应的时间嵌入向量相加,从而将时间信息编码到数据中。这种技术可以提高模型的性能,尤其是在处理时间序列数据时表现突出。
### 回答2:
时序嵌入补丁(Temporal embedding patch)是一种用于时间序列数据建模的技术。在时间序列数据中,每个数据点都是按照一定时间间隔进行采样的,这些数据点的顺序和时间间隔可以提供有关数据的重要信息。然而,传统的机器学习算法并不擅长处理时间序列数据,因此需要采用一些特殊的方法来将时间序列的时序信息引入模型中。
时序嵌入补丁就是一种通过将时间序列数据转化为固定维度的向量表示的方法,从而能够应用于传统的机器学习算法中。该技术基于时间滑窗的思想,将一段时间窗口内的数据点按照一定的步长进行滑动,并提取出每个滑窗窗口内的数据序列,然后将这些序列转化为一个固定维度的向量表示。
时序嵌入补丁的过程主要包括以下几个步骤:首先,选择合适的时间窗口大小和步长;然后,将滑窗内的时间序列数据转化为固定维度的向量表示,可以使用一些经典的特征提取方法,如傅立叶变换、小波变换等;最后,将得到的向量表示与原始数据进行融合,得到一个新的特征表示。
时序嵌入补丁的优势在于将时间序列数据转化为固定维度的向量表示,使得传统的机器学习算法能够直接应用于时间序列数据的建模和预测任务中。它可以提取出时间序列数据中的关键特征,并且可以捕捉到时间序列数据的时序信息,从而提高模型的性能和泛化能力。因此,在时间序列数据的处理和分析中,时序嵌入补丁是一种常用的有效方法。
### 回答3:
时序嵌入补丁是一种将时间信息嵌入到数据中的技术。在很多应用中,我们经常需要处理时间序列数据,如股票价格、气象数据等。然而,传统的机器学习算法对于时间序列的建模并不擅长,很难捕捉到时间的演化规律。
时序嵌入补丁技术可以帮助我们更好地进行时间序列数据的特征提取,从而提高建模效果。具体而言,它是通过将时间信息作为特征进行编码,将当前观测值与其前后一定时间窗口内的观测值联系起来,生成一个新的、更加丰富的特征表示。
时序嵌入补丁的实现方式有很多种,其中较为常见的方式是基于滑动窗口的方法。简单来说,对于给定的时间序列数据,我们可以选择一个固定的时间窗口大小,将这个窗口内的数据作为输入,然后通过滑动窗口的方式将窗口向前移动,不断提取新的特征。
通过时序嵌入补丁技术,我们可以将时间信息融入到数据的特征表示中,更好地反映时间序列数据的演化规律,提高模型的准确性。它在诸多领域有着广泛的应用,如金融预测、交通流量预测、医学时间序列分析等。这种技术的发展将进一步促进我们对时间序列数据的建模和分析能力的提升。
反序列化上传webshell,如何分析shell,如何应急处理
反序列化上传webshell是一种常见的攻击方式,攻击者可以通过该方式获得服务器的控制权,对服务器进行恶意操作。一旦发现服务器被上传了webshell,需要立即采取应急处理措施,避免服务器被攻击者利用。
下面是分析反序列化上传webshell的步骤和应急处理措施:
1. 分析shell
首先,需要分析上传的webshell的代码,确定webshell的功能和攻击者的意图。可以使用文本编辑器或代码审计工具来查看webshell的代码。在分析过程中需要注意以下几点:
- 查看webshell是否包含可疑的函数或命令。
- 检查webshell是否有与其他文件交互的能力,例如读写文件、执行命令等。
- 检查webshell是否包含加密或解密的代码。
- 检查webshell是否具有自动化攻击能力。
2. 应急处理
一旦发现服务器被上传了webshell,需要立即进行应急处理,以避免服务器被攻击者利用。以下是应急处理的步骤:
- 立即断开服务器与互联网的连接,避免攻击者继续利用服务器进行攻击。
- 检查上传时间和上传路径,找出攻击者可能的入口和攻击路径。
- 修改服务器的密码和密钥,以避免被攻击者利用。
- 删除上传的webshell和攻击者可能留下的其他恶意文件。
- 检查服务器的日志文件,找出攻击者的攻击痕迹。
- 确定安全漏洞并修复,防止类似攻击再次发生。
以上是分析反序列化上传webshell的步骤和应急处理措施,可以有效减少服务器被攻击的风险。同时,为了避免类似攻击再次发生,建议加强服务器的安全防护,及时更新操作系统和软件补丁,加强访问控制和权限控制等。